#275039 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#275039 is composed of 15.3% red, 31.4%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.8% yellow and 68.6% black. It has a hue angle of 146.3 degrees, a saturation of 34.5% and a lightness of 23.3%. #275039 color hex could be obtained by blending #4ea072 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#275039

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f3f9f5 is the lightest one.
